Description

NHS North East London (NEL) Integrated Care Board (ICB) (hereafter referred to as "the Authority") is seeking to commission Homeless Health Primary Care and Outreach Service for People Experiencing Homelessness ("the Services"). The model of care across NEL will cover all forms of homelessness but will most likely be used by those that are rough sleeping or people living in accommodation such as hostels and shelters, including people seeking asylum. The service will be delivered from 5 sites, namely: The Greenhouse Walk In (City & Hackney) - 19 Tudor Road, Hackney, London E9 7SN Health E1 (Tower Hamlets) - Mile End Hospital, Spitalfields Health Centre, 9-11 Brick Lane, London E1 6RF Newham Transition - Vicarage Lane Health Centre, 10 Vicarage Lane, London E15 4ES The Centre Manor Park, 30 Church Road, London E12 6AQ Forest Road Medical Centre (Waltham Forest) - 354-358 Forest Road, Walthamstow Loxford Health Centre (Redbridge & Barking & Dagenham) - 417 Ilford Lane, Redbridge The decisions applicable to this Procurement will be made by the Authority. The Procurement is being managed by NHS London Commercial Hub (NHS LCH) hosted by NHS North East London, on behalf of the Authority, in connection with an Invitation to Tender (ITT) exercise that is being conducted, based on the competitive process under the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) regulations 2023 ("the Regulations" (as amended). None of the references to "ITT", "Bid", or the use of the term "tender process", or any other indication, shall be taken to mean that the Authority intends to hold itself bound to any of the Regulations, save those applicable to PSR provisions regarding the Competitive Process. Further information regarding the Authority is available from: https://northeastlondon.icb.nhs.uk/ The lifetime Value of the contract is £33,908,220.00 The contract term is for five (5) years with an option for extension of further five (5) years at the sole discretion of the Authority. The contract will start on 01/04/2027 and end 31/03/2032, if the optional extension is utilised the contract end date will be 31/03/2037. The maximum duration of the contract is 10 years (120 months).

Other Information

This is a Provider Selection Regime (PSR) Contract Notice inviting offers under the Competitive process (The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023, Regulation 11) . The awarding of this contract is subject to the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023. For avoidance of doubt the provisions of the Procurement Act 2023 do not apply to this award.
